+<li> <a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-7154">HADOOP-7154</a>.
+     Minor improvement reported by tlipcon and fixed by tlipcon (scripts)<br>
+     <b>Should set MALLOC_ARENA_MAX in hadoop-config.sh</b><br>
+     <blockquote>New versions of glibc present in RHEL6 include a new arena allocator design. In several clusters we&apos;ve seen this new allocator cause huge amounts of virtual memory to be used, since when multiple threads perform allocations, they each get their own memory arena. On a 64-bit system, these arenas are 64M mappings, and the maximum number of arenas is 8 times the number of cores. We&apos;ve observed a DN process using 14GB of vmem for only 300M of resident set. This causes all kinds of nasty issues fo...</blockquote></li>

+<li> <a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HDFS-3652">HDFS-3652</a>.
+     Blocker bug reported by tlipcon and fixed by tlipcon (name-node)<br>
+     <b>1.x: FSEditLog failure removes the wrong edit stream when storage dirs have same name</b><br>
+     <blockquote>In {{FSEditLog.removeEditsForStorageDir}}, we iterate over the edits streams trying to find the stream corresponding to a given dir. To check equality, we currently use the following condition:<br>{code}<br>      File parentDir = getStorageDirForStream(idx);<br>      if (parentDir.getName().equals(sd.getRoot().getName())) {<br>{code}<br>... which is horribly incorrect. If two or more storage dirs happen to have the same terminal path component (eg /data/1/nn and /data/2/nn) then it will pick the wrong strea...</blockquote></li>
